Product Introduction & Engineering Value

When an automation project expands beyond basic PLC logic, processor performance quickly becomes a limiting factor. Large control programs, extensive I/O mapping, Ethernet communications, and floating-point calculations all compete for CPU resources. The GE IC698CPE030 was designed to handle these workloads within the PACSystems RX7i platform.

Built around a 600 MHz Pentium M processor, the IC698CPE030 combines high processing speed, generous memory capacity, embedded networking, and support for multiple IEC programming languages. It is widely used in process industries where continuous operation and scalable system architecture are priorities.

 

Technical Specifications

Parameter Specification
Manufacturer GE Fanuc / Emerson
Model IC698CPE030
Product Family PACSystems RX7i
CPU Type Floating Point Central Processing Unit
Processor 600 MHz Intel Pentium M
User RAM 64 MB Battery-Backed
User Flash Memory 64 MB Non-Volatile
Boolean Execution Speed Typical 0.069 ms per 1,000 Boolean Contacts/Coils
Maximum Discrete I/O 32K Bits
Maximum Analog I/O 32K Words
Embedded Ethernet Two Auto-Sensing 10/100Base-T Ports
Serial Interfaces RS-232, RS-485, Dedicated Station Manager Port
Supported Protocols SRTP, Ethernet Global Data (EGD), Modbus TCP Server/Client, SNP, Modbus RTU Slave
Programming Languages Ladder Diagram, Structured Text, Function Block Diagram, C
Operating Temperature 0–50°C (0–60°C with Fan Tray)
Backplane RX7i VME64 Architecture

 

Field Application & The “Trench” Experience

A large wastewater treatment facility expanded its process by adding nutrient removal, remote pumping stations, and additional operator workstations. The original control strategy remained effective, but the existing processor struggled to manage the increased Ethernet traffic and expanded control logic.

Engineers upgraded the controller to an IC698CPE030 during a scheduled maintenance outage. After downloading the existing project and validating network parameters, the PLC resumed operation with improved scan performance while maintaining compatibility with installed RX7i I/O modules and SCADA communications.

Typical application scenarios include:

  • Combined-cycle power plant auxiliary control
  • Wastewater treatment process automation
  • High-speed packaging and palletizing systems
  • Steel continuous casting control
  • Chemical batch processing with distributed Ethernet I/O

The Veteran’s Tech Trap Guide

⚠️ Firmware Compatibility Should Be Verified First

Before replacing an existing RX7i CPU, confirm that the installed firmware revision is compatible with your Proficy Machine Edition project and other intelligent modules. Firmware mismatches can prevent successful project downloads or module initialization.

⚠️ Record the Network Configuration Before Removal

The processor contains embedded Ethernet interfaces. Always document the IP address, subnet mask, gateway, and communication settings before replacing the CPU to avoid unnecessary commissioning delays.

PRO TIP:

A processor that appears offline is often responding to an IP address conflict, incorrect subnet configuration, or disabled Ethernet service—not a failed CPU. Verify network diagnostics before replacing hardware.

⚠️ Use Forced Cooling When Required

The IC698CPE030 may operate up to 60°C only when an approved RX7i fan tray is installed. Systems operating without forced airflow should remain within the lower ambient temperature specification.
